Hi,

Can I use this GDPicture in Excel 2007 VBA?
If yes, how... could you please post some examples and documentation around this?

Also wanted to know if this is royalty free licensing?

Theoretically yes, Excel does accept ActiveX controls in developer mode so you should be able to use GdPicture.NET even though we never tried.
We can't provide specific documentation for Excel because we already provide extensive Access demo application with our SDK installation package and it is pretty much the same thing (VBA).
To learn how to include ActiveX controls in Excel I suggest you refer to the Microsoft documentation, or search online, there are multiple guides like this one for instance.
You should also refer to our online documentation about using GdPicture.NET as an COM/ActiveX component here: https://www.gdpicture.com/guides/gdpicture/Usi ... tiveX.html
